KWEB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2021 in Review
233 of the 5,711 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in KraneShares CSI China Internet ETF (KWEB) for Q1 2021, worth a combined $1.84B — up 0.68% from $1.82B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 46 funds opened new KWEB positions and 44 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 83 added to existing stakes and 68 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$45.1M.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$93.2M.
